lightbulbAbout this topic
Time Difference of Arrival (TDOA) is a localization technique used in signal processing and telecommunications, where the difference in arrival times of a signal at multiple receivers is measured to determine the source's location. It relies on the principles of triangulation and requires precise timing and synchronization among the receiving stations.
